The circuitry for the Sport gauge cluster isn't shown in the '88 EVTM, only for the Turbo Coupe(I'd guess they are similar)...

That said, the problem is most likely the gauge it's self, problem is likely the small "C" magnet inside the gauge is dead, I've never seen one work in a TC either...  I've opened a gauge, "re-charged" the magnet with a large one and it worked for a couple weeks before it went numb again...

My recommendation is install a volt meter and forget the original gauge...

CONVENTIONAL AMMETER
A conventional ammeter must be connected between the battery and alternator in order to indicate current flow. This type ammeter, Fig. 1, consists of a frame to which a permanent magnet is attached. The frame also supports an armature and pointer assembly. Current in this system flows from the alternator through the ammeter, then to the battery or from the battery through the ammeter into the vehicle electrical system, depending on vehicle operating conditions.
When no current flows through the ammeter, the magnet holds the pointer armature so that the pointer stands at the center of the dial. When current passes in either direction through the ammeter, the resulting magnetic field attracts the armature away from the effect of the permanent magnet, thus giving a reading proportional to the strength of the current flowing.
Troubleshooting
When the ammeter apparently fails to register correctly, there may be trouble in the wiring which connects the ammeter to the alternator and battery or in the alternator or battery itself. To check the connections, first tighten the two terminal posts on the back of the ammeter. Then, following each wire from the ammeter, tighten all connections on the ignition switch, battery and alternator. Chafed, burned or broken insulation can be found by following each ammeter wire from end to end.All wires with chafed, burned or broken insulation should be repaired or replaced. After this is done, and all connections are tightened, connect the battery cable and turn on the ignition switch. The needle should point slightly to the discharge ( - ) side.
Start the engine and speed it up a little above idling speed. The needle should then move to the charge side (+), and its movement should be smooth.If the pointer does not behave correctly, the ammeter itself is out of order and a new one should be installed.

SHUNT TYPE AMMETER
The shunt type ammeter is actually a specially calibrated voltmeter. It is connected to read voltage drop across a resistance wire (shunt) between the battery and alternator. The shunt is located either in the vehicle wiring or within the ammeter itself.When voltage is higher at the alternator end of the shunt, the meter indicates a charge (+) condition. When voltage is higher at the battery end of the shunt, the meter indicates a discharge ( - ) condition. When voltage is equal at both ends of the shunt, the meter reads zero.
Troubleshooting
Ammeter accuracy can be determined by comparing reading with an ammeter of known accuracy.

    With engine stopped and ignition switch in RUN position, switch on headlamps and heater fan. Meter should indicate a discharge ( - ) condition.
    If ammeter pointer does not move, check ammeter terminals for proper connection and check for open circuit in wiring harness. If connections and wiring harness are satisfactory, ammeter is defective.
    If ammeter indicates a charge (+) condition, wiring harness connections are reversed at ammeter.

The dash gauge is a shunt unit. The shunt is incorporated in the wiring harness. I think it only shows a charge rate according to the print. Not 100% on this!!  Reason i say this is because it is in the alternators heavy charge wire. It is not wired in to the cars battery supply side. This is according to the print i am looking at. Either way you can test the gauge portion with an OHM meter. The gauge is a micro volt meter of sorts and measures the voltage drop across the shunt. If you hook an OHM meter across it out of the car you should get it to move with the shunt now not in the circuit and i would think the battery from an buttstuffog meter should have enough battery on the low OHM scale to move the needle. I have several turbo coupe and mustang gauge clusters i will test one tonight. That is as simple as i can explain it. It looks like the entire load does not come through the wiring as i see it. Could be wrong but that is what i see. Hope this helps.
